Eligibility To become an IAS is
1. Must be graduate (% doesn't matter)
2. age limit for general candidate 21 to 30, for OBC 21 to 33, for SC/ST 21 to 35.
if you are fullfill these criteria then you can appear the upsc exam otherwise Sorry
